About Me:
Served 4 years USN as HM2 with naval and USMC units.
At Cuban Missile Crisis 1962 with helo-assault Marines from 1/6 on board Okinawa and later Thetis Bay{LPH-6}.
NATO assignment in spring/summer of 1963 with same Marines on board Francis Marion and later Yancey.
Enjoyed Marine and shipboard duty over hospital time.
